There are two places to look to see the law about small claims. First, research the Statute of Limitations in the state where you will be filing the suit. 4. For instance, in California, you'll need to pay $30 if you're pursuing up to $1,500, $50 if you're looking to collect up to $5,000 and $75 if you're trying to collect up to $10,000. Once the documents have been served, you will be required to file a "proof of service" with the court so that the judge knows the defendant received proper notice of the hearing date.
